Oooh. That's nasty. I bet that drove him nutz. I had an overtemp  
problem with Peyote for awhile that turned out to be the intake hose  
sucking flat.
On Jul 10, 2008, at 10:47 AM, Norlin Engineering wrote:

> Take a look at the inside of the fuel hoses.  Sounds similar to a  
> problem a
> friend had years ago.  A small flap was cut on the inside of one of  
> the
> hoses and when the fuel flow got to a certain point, the flap closed  
> just
> like a check valve.

> Folks:  My 1296 pulls easily to 7000 rpm, slowing 90 hp on the  
> chassis dyno
> and Fuel/Air at 13.0.  At 7,000 I abruptly lose 20 hp and the fuel/ 
> air goes
> to 17.  I get the same affect on 1 1/2 and 1 1/4 SUs.  Any ideas? Dale
